A RESOLUTION OF TH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E
CITY OF SANTA ANA ESTABLISHING GUIDES TO
SCREENING OF MECHANICAL EQUIPMENT OR
APPURTENANCE~ PURSUANT TO SECTION 41-622
OF THE SANTA ANA MUNICIPAL CODE.
WHEREAS, the Santa Ana Planning Commission held a public
hearing at a regularly scheduled meeting on November 27, 1972
on a proposed amendment to the zoning ordinance of the City of
Santa Ana pertaining to the screening of mechanical equipment
or appurtenances on buildings which are hereafter constructed
or expanded; and
WHEREAS, following said hearing the Santa Ana Planning
Commission did by Resolution No. 6017 recommend to the City
Council the adoption of said proposed amendment to zoning ordi-
nance consisting of new Section 41-210 and Section 41-622 of
the Santa Ana Municipal Code on November 27, 1972; and
WHEREAS, on November 27, 1972 by Resolution No. 6108, the
Santa Ana Planning Commission did further recommend the adoption
and approval of guides to screening of mechanical equipment for
appurtenances;
NOW, THEREFORE, the City Council of the City of Santa Aha
does resolve that, pursuant to Section 41-622 of the Santa Ana
Municipal Code, the following "Guides to Screening of Mechanical
Equipment or Appurtenances" are approved and shall read as follows:
GUIDES TO SCREENING OF MECHANICAL EQUIPMENT
AND APPURTENANCES
Conformance with the following requirements will adequately
screen mechanical equipment or appurtenances on the roof or
exterior of a building:
Ail roof-mounted mechanical equipment and/or
appurtenances, which project vertically more
than one and one-half (1-1/2~ feet above the
roof or roof parapet, are to be screened by an
enclosure which is detailed consistent with the
building.
Ail roof-mounted mechanical equipment and/or
appurtenances, which project one and one-half
(1-1/2) feet or less above the roof or roof
parapet are to be painted consistent with the
color scheme of the building in all cases.
No mechanical equipment or appurtenances are
to be exposed on the wall surface of a building.

Exhaust fans shall be screened by a wall, a
fence or landscape materials and be located
below the fascia and/or roof line of the
building. Further, they shall be located
on the rear or "hidden" side of the building,
to be painted to match the surface to which
attached, if visible.

Incinerator vents are to be located on the rear
or "hidden" side of the building in all cases.
Roof-mounted ventilators are to be a maximum of
one and one-half (1-1/2) feet above the point
to which attached and are to be painted or pre-
finished consistent with the color scheme of
the building unless screened by a parapet wall.
Vents, louvers, exposed flashing, tanks, stacks,
overhead doors, roofing service doors, sliding
doors and all other doors are to be painted con-
sistent with the color scheme of the building.
The materials, placement and structural support
of screens shall be in conformity with the pro-
visions of Chapter VIII, Santa Ana Municipal
Code.
BE IT FURTHER RESOLVED that the Santa Ana City Council
finds that the proposed guides will not be detrimental to
the general plan.
